1. Causes of leucorrhea during menstruation

1. It is normal to have a small amount of leucorrhea during menstruation, which may be caused by estrogen and progesterone secreted by the ovaries. It is not necessary to ovulate, leucorrhea has this characteristic.

2. This situation is also normal. Menstrual blood flows out of the uterine cavity, while leucorrhea is the secretion from the vagina. The vagina is affected by sex hormones and also undergoes cyclical changes. As long as there is no odor or itching, it is not a big deal. It is recommended that you don’t worry about it and just keep warm during menstruation.

3. In addition to blood, blood clots, and endometrial fragments, menstruation also contains cervical mucus and vaginal epithelium. So if you see stringy leucorrhea in your menstrual blood, this is cervical mucus, which is normal.

2. What does menstruation mean?

Menstruation is a physiological cycle that occurs in some fertile female humans and in chimpanzees and other hominins. Cows, horses, camels, pigs, and sheep also menstruate, and some mammals experience estrus cycles. In women of childbearing age and female primates, the endometrium undergoes cyclical changes every month or so, with autonomous thickening, blood vessel proliferation, glandular growth and secretion, and endometrial collapse and shedding accompanied by bleeding. This periodic vaginal discharge or uterine bleeding is called menstruation.
